This is one of the very first garments I ever designed (2-3 years ago). And I tell you, when you are learning, there is no replacement for doing. Even when you don't know what you are doing, you learn so much just in the trying and learning from experience. Like I learned when you are doing a drop shoulder, that the sleeves need to be shorter to compensate for the extra fabric at the shoulder. I also learned that in a cardigan, the neck doesn't have to be as big because there is plenty of room because of the split fronts. As you can see, I had to add a few extra rows around the neck and front edge to help close-up the neck a bit. I also learned, that if you make something purple and add a little fuzz/sparkle to it, even a very picky 5 year old (at the time) will wear it with pride, even if it's not perfect.
